Title: Don Carter Style wrist brace
Post by: LuckyLefty on January 07, 2007, 03:01:14 PM
Well these things are OLD.

Sort of a palm pad with a cushion and then a metal bar only in the back.

I had tried them before when I had a really stretched span and liked them...but the palm pad had a tendancy to want to kick my thumb out of the ball a little too quick.

Saw a guy today using one and I said...hmmmm somewhere in my bag I have one with that palm pad....(His was a glove with a metal backing and the palm pad).
Mine is just a small wrist brace with a stiff back and palm pad.

I was using a more relaxed span and put on ....and sweet!
NO extra revs(I tend to get my most revs without a wrist brace!).

But this palm pad was a much better fit with a slightly shorter than stretched span.  INSTANTLY i noticed more push for the ball and a slight feeling of more tilt and a feeling of being a slightly lower track almost a semispinner.

I really was getting a very nice reaction after I put this on!

In comparison to my little leather Robbie's wrist minder...with the Robbies I get a firn ride but a heavier roll....(than this Don Carter wrist brace) and a seemingly a higher track!
